Thumbnail queue (Pixelgrove) — restart procedure. If the thumb-gen workers stall, check the dead-letter count first. Over 500: drain with the reaper script in ops/tools, then restart workers two at a time. Never restart all at once; the resize pool will thrash. Verify new thumbnails appear within 90 seconds on the staging gallery. If not, escalate to the Mediaflow on-call rotation. When filing the escalation, include the trace token shown below.

pipeline stamp: htk31_f769b577b3028a4e9958e5bb8d1259a

# FD-Hunt Environments — Larkspool Gateway

This page tracks the environments used while chasing the leaked file descriptors in the Larkspool Gateway. The soak rig mirrors production load at one-tenth scale and runs with descriptor accounting enabled, which adds roughly 4% overhead. Do not promote a build until the soak rig holds steady for 48 hours. The soak rig currently runs with these configuration values.

deployment values, kajep-kageg:
[praix]
host = praix.paliqcorp.corp
user = praix_svc
database = praix_prod

Handover note — Crumbwheel order cutoffs.

Welcome aboard. The bakery cutoff rule in Crumbwheel closes same-day orders at 14:00 local to each storefront, not UTC — this has bitten us twice. Holiday overrides live in the calendar service and take precedence silently, so always check there first when a cutoff looks wrong. To unlock the calendar service's admin console after a restart, enter the recovery passphrase below.

vault phrase of bagap-bahaf = silion-pelox-sorox-casdor-quenwyn-fraax-eliox-praael-kelion-quenvan-kasox-rusael-norius-belvan

Sweepling walks the Tarnwood inventory once an hour and deletes volumes, snapshots, and load balancers that have no owning deployment record. It's deliberately cautious: a resource must show up orphaned in two consecutive sweeps before deletion, and anything tagged keep-forever is skipped. If it starts reaping things it shouldn't, check the grace window first — that's usually what someone shortened. Dry-run mode logs intent without deleting. The sweeper reads its settings at startup, shown here.

config for tajof-tajef:
ralael:
  pin: 3468
  metrics_host: metrics.ralael.lumicsys.internal
  tenant: casath
  seal: seal_c325d9c6